Frozen Pea and Onion
vegetables SR Legacy · per 100g
Frozen Pea and Onion provides 70 kcal per 100g, with 4.0 g protein, 0.3 g fat, and 13.5 g carbohydrates. It is a notable source of Thiamin (B1) (0.297 mg, 25% RDA), Iron (1.5 mg, 19% RDA), Vitamin C (14 mg, 16% RDA), Manganese (0.274 mg, 12% RDA), Copper (0.103 mg, 11% RDA), Folate (DFE) (45 mcg, 11% RDA), and Vitamin B6 (0.144 mg, 11% RDA). Nutrient data from USDA FoodData Central (SR Legacy dataset), per 100g edible portion.
